#c16e05 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c16e05 is composed of 75.7% red, 43.1%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43% magenta, 97.4%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 33.5 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 38.8%. #c16e05 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dc0a with #830000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

Shades and Tints of #c16e05
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fff7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#c16e05
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666360 is the less saturated color, while #c16e05 is the most saturated one.
